Wea Ridge Middle School is a public middle school located off of South 18th Street in Lafayette, Indiana. During the 2006-2007 school year it housed grades 6-8, as well as kindergarten classes for Wea Ridge Elementary School. Its principal is currently Corey Marshall, and the assistant principal is Michelle Sanson. The school mascot is the Husky, and the school colors are maroon, white, and black.

Sports

Wea Ridge's main rivals in sports are the Southwestern Wildcats, Battle Ground Tomahawks, and the Techumseh Braves.

In the 2006-2007 school year, the Wea Ridge Huskies Football team won the WCJC Championship by beating Twin Lakes 14-0.

Wea Ridge also holds a Dodgeball Tournament each year that any student can compete in.
